Property Crime in 39426, MS

Our analysis gives 39426 a property crime grade of: A-. 39426 is in the 18th percentile of safety, meaning 18% of cities in Mississippi are safer and 82% are more dangerous. Please visit our 39426 crime map for details on how this is calculated and what it means.

So, is 39426 safe? Compared to all of Mississippi, 39426 is rated safer than the average Mississippi zip, which has a property crime rate of 25.42 per 1000. Looking at burglary, we see a different pattern, where 39426, with its burglary rate of 4.047 per 1000, is as safe as the average Mississippi zip.

In addition, 39426 is lower than other zip codes with similar populations for property crime. The table below shows property crime rates and level of occurrence in 39426, MS.

Self-Monitored or Professionally Monitored?

Any home security system you pick will offer a selection of equipment including entry sensors, cameras, etc. The question is, do you actually want to self-monitor your system? If like 14.80% (2,698) of people in 39426, you are a renter, you might prefer a self-monitored home security system. On the other hand, 85.20% or 15,531 of 39426 residents own their homes and may be more likely to consider a professionally monitored system to protect their property.

Whether you rent or buy, how well can you monitor your system on your own? For example, if you're one of the 90% of people who commute an average of 49 minutes to work in or around 39426, can you immediately receive notifications on your phone, check cameras in meetings or while working, and call the police if needed?

If not, you might want a professionally monitored system where a company is available 24/7 to respond, whether on vacation or at work. Please see our comprehensive guide on the best home security systems for a complete comparison.
